The Four Steps to the Epiphany is a book written by Steve Blank. It is about the process of starting and growing a successful business.

Some key takeaways from The Four Steps to the Epiphany by Steve Blank include:

  1. The process of starting and growing a business can be divided into four steps: These include the Customer Discovery phase, the Customer Validation phase, the Customer Creation phase, and the Company Building phase.

  2. In the Customer Discovery phase, you learn about the needs and preferences of potential customers: This is important because without understanding your customers, it is difficult to create a product or service that they will want to buy.

  3. In the Customer Validation phase, you test your product or service with potential customers: This can be done through things like market research and customer feedback. By validating your product or service, you can make sure it is something that customers will be willing to buy.

  4. In the Customer Creation phase, you promote your product or service to potential customers: This can be done through things like marketing and sales efforts. By creating customers, you can grow your business and generate revenue.

  5. In the Company Building phase, you scale up your business and make it more efficient and effective: This can include things like hiring more staff, expanding into new markets, and improving your operations. By building your company, you can achieve long-term success and growth.
